Rexdale Women's Centre is an independent, not-for-profit, voluntary agency that serves high-need women and their families, residing in the Greater Toronto Area of Canada.

OBS

[The centre's] mission is to support immigrant, newcomer and refugee women, and their family members of all generations to become fully participating members of Canadian Society who are self-sufficient, financially secure, safe, happy, healthy and socially active. They accomplish this by enhancing [their] client's individual functioning skills and by facilitating their access to resources, agencies, and community services.

OBS

The Centre offers the following programs and services: Newcomer Assistance and Integration, Violence Prevention and Crisis Intervention, Support and Employment for Women, Parenting, Children's Services, Ethno-Cultural Seniors Programs, Internet Access Computers, Welcoming Communities Program, Eating for Two, Feeding with Love, [and] Language Training.
